Update to bzcarbon2

This commit is contained in:
Simon Brodtmann 2025-10-19 17:53:59 +02:00
parent cdd969fd2b
commit ecfba8e78d
2 changed files with 7 additions and 7 deletions

View file

@ -118,8 +118,8 @@ if util.me.founding_plates() then
name = "advanced-founding", name = "advanced-founding",
icons = { icons = {
{icon = "__bzfoundry2__/graphics/icons/technology/foundry.png", icon_size = 256}, {icon = "__bzfoundry2__/graphics/icons/technology/foundry.png", icon_size = 256},
(mods.bzcarbon and (mods["bzcarbon2"] and
{ icon = "__bzcarbon__/graphics/icons/graphite-2.png", { icon = "__bzcarbon2__/graphics/icons/graphite-2.png",
icon_size = 128, scale=0.5, shift={32, -32}}) icon_size = 128, scale=0.5, shift={32, -32}})
or (mods.bzsilicon and or (mods.bzsilicon and
{ icon = "__bzsilicon__/graphics/icons/silica.png", { icon = "__bzsilicon__/graphics/icons/silica.png",
@ -154,8 +154,8 @@ if util.me.founding_plates() then
name = "advanced-founding-space", name = "advanced-founding-space",
icons = { icons = {
{icon = "__bzfoundry2__/graphics/icons/technology/foundry.png", icon_size = 256}, {icon = "__bzfoundry2__/graphics/icons/technology/foundry.png", icon_size = 256},
(mods.bzcarbon and (mods["bzcarbon2"] and
{ icon = "__bzcarbon__/graphics/icons/graphite-2.png", { icon = "__bzcarbon2__/graphics/icons/graphite-2.png",
icon_size = 128, scale=0.5, shift={32, -32}}) icon_size = 128, scale=0.5, shift={32, -32}})
or (mods.bzsilicon and or (mods.bzsilicon and
{ icon = "__bzsilicon__/graphics/icons/silica.png", { icon = "__bzsilicon__/graphics/icons/silica.png",

View file

@ -51,8 +51,8 @@ function make_recipe(recipe)
icons = rusty_icons.of(data.raw.recipe[recipe.name]) icons = rusty_icons.of(data.raw.recipe[recipe.name])
table.insert( table.insert(
icons, icons,
(mods.bzcarbon and (mods["bzcarbon2"] and
{ icon = "__bzcarbon__/graphics/icons/graphite-2.png", { icon = "__bzcarbon2__/graphics/icons/graphite-2.png",
icon_size = 128, scale=0.125, shift={8, -8}}) icon_size = 128, scale=0.125, shift={8, -8}})
or (mods.bzsilicon and or (mods.bzsilicon and
{ icon = "__bzsilicon__/graphics/icons/silica.png", { icon = "__bzsilicon__/graphics/icons/silica.png",
@ -82,7 +82,7 @@ end
-- TODO make this more varied and interesting based on reality -- TODO make this more varied and interesting based on reality
function get_refractories(recipe, name) function get_refractories(recipe, name)
local refractories = {} local refractories = {}
if mods.bzcarbon then table.insert(refractories, "graphite") end if mods["bzcarbon2"] then table.insert(refractories, "graphite") end
if mods.bzsilicon then table.insert(refractories, "silica") end if mods.bzsilicon then table.insert(refractories, "silica") end
if #refractories < 2 and mods.bzzirconium and name ~= "zirconium-plate-refractory" then table.insert(refractories, "zirconia") end if #refractories < 2 and mods.bzzirconium and name ~= "zirconium-plate-refractory" then table.insert(refractories, "zirconia") end
if #refractories < 2 and mods.bzaluminum2 and name ~= "aluminum-plate-refractory" then table.insert(refractories, "alumina") end if #refractories < 2 and mods.bzaluminum2 and name ~= "aluminum-plate-refractory" then table.insert(refractories, "alumina") end